在电子表格处理软件中,存在一个用于逻辑判断的核心函数,它能够对多个给定的条件进行“与”运算。这个函数的作用是,仅当所有参与运算的条件都返回“真”值时,它才会最终输出“真”;反之,只要其中任何一个条件为“假”,它的最终结果便是“假”。我们可以将其理解为一道严格的多重关卡,数据必须依次通过每一道关卡的检验,才能获得最终的通行许可。
核心功能定位 该函数的核心角色是充当一个逻辑检验员。它不直接处理数值计算或文本拼接,而是专注于评估一系列陈述是否同时成立。例如,在筛选员工信息时,我们可能需要同时满足“年龄大于30岁”且“部门为销售部”两个条件,此时便需要借助该函数的力量来进行综合判断。 典型应用场景 它的身影频繁出现在条件格式设置、数据筛选以及与其他函数嵌套使用的场景中。特别是在与“如果”系列函数搭配时,它能构建出非常精细的多层判断逻辑。比如,在计算销售提成时,可以设定只有当“销售额超过基准线”与“回款状态为已完成”两个前提同时满足时,才触发提成计算公式,否则结果返回零或特定提示文本。 基本语法构成 使用该函数时,需要在其括号内依次列出需要判断的条件,这些条件可以是直接的比较表达式(如A1>10),也可以是其他能返回逻辑值(真或假)的函数。理论上,它可以接受多达255个条件参数,但实际应用中通常以两到三个条件的组合最为常见和清晰。其输出结果非真即假,非常纯粹,这为后续的流程控制提供了坚实的基础。 与互补函数的区别 在逻辑函数家族中,它与另一个代表“或”运算的函数形成鲜明对比。前者要求所有条件像串联电路一样全部导通,后者则像并联电路,只需任意一个条件导通即可。理解这一根本区别,是正确选用它们的关键。在实际工作中,根据判断逻辑的严谨性要求,灵活选择“全部满足”或是“满足其一”,能极大地提升数据处理的效率和准确性。在数据处理与分析领域,逻辑判断是构建智能表格的基石。其中,承担“与”运算职责的函数,犹如一位严谨的联合审查官,它对提交上来的多项条件进行逐一审核,并仅在全部条件符合要求时亮起绿灯。本文将深入剖析这一函数的多元面貌,从其内在机制到外延应用,进行系统性的阐述。
一、 函数本质与运行机理探析 从计算机逻辑学的角度看,此函数实现的是逻辑“与”操作。它严格遵循布尔代数的运算规则:输入一系列逻辑命题,输出它们的合取结果。其内部处理过程可以形象化为一个多阶段的过滤器。数据或表达式作为输入值进入函数,函数会从左至右依次评估每个参数的真假值。评估过程中,一旦遇到第一个结果为“假”的条件,函数便会立即终止后续条件的判断,直接返回“假”。这种“短路求值”的特性,不仅符合逻辑常识,也在某些情况下能提升公式的运算效率。只有当所有条件都顺利通过,评估之旅抵达终点,函数才会返回最终的“真”值。这种非黑即白的输出特性,使其成为构建确定性判断规则的理想工具。 二、 语法结构深度解读与参数剖析 该函数的语法结构清晰而直接,其形式为:函数名(条件1, [条件2], …)。其中,“条件1”是必需参数,代表第一个需要检验的逻辑表达式。后续的“条件2”等为可选参数,允许用户根据需要添加更多的检验条件,上限数量相当充裕,足以应对绝大多数复杂场景。每一个“条件”参数,都可以是丰富多样的形态:它可以是诸如“B5>100”这类直接的比较运算;可以是引用另一个单元格,该单元格本身包含逻辑值;也可以是其他任何函数的嵌套,只要该嵌套函数的最终返回值是逻辑值“真”或“假”即可。值得注意的是,当参数不是明确的逻辑值时,例如数字或文本,函数会遵循特定的规则进行隐式转换。通常,数字0被视为“假”,任何非零数字被视为“真”;空文本一般被视为“假”。了解这些细节,有助于避免在实际应用中因类型混淆而产生意料之外的结果。 三、 核心应用领域与实战技巧荟萃 该函数的强大在于其与其他功能的联动,以下是几个经典的应用维度: 首先,在与条件判断函数结合时,它能构建多层决策树。例如,公式“=IF(AND(销售额>目标额, 客户评级=”A”), 销售额0.1, 销售额0.05)”,精准地实现了对不同等级客户采用不同提成比例的计算。其次,在条件格式设定中,它用于定义复杂的突出显示规则。比如,可以设置当“库存数量小于安全库存”且“物品状态为在售”时,自动将该行单元格背景标红预警,实现数据的可视化监控。再者,在高级数据筛选中,虽然界面操作直观,但通过在筛选条件区域使用包含此函数的公式,可以实现更为动态和复杂的自定义筛选逻辑。最后,在数组公式或最新动态数组函数的运用中,它能够参与对一组数据进行批量逻辑测试,配合求和或计数函数,便能轻松统计出满足多重条件的记录数量,例如统计某个地区且销售额超过一定阈值的销售代表人数。 四、 常见误区与使用注意事项提醒 即使对于熟练用户,以下几个陷阱也值得警惕:其一,混淆“与”和“或”的逻辑关系。需要反复问自己:是要求所有条件同时成立,还是只需其中一个成立?这是选对函数的第一步。其二,参数中直接使用文本字符串而未添加引号。例如,判断单元格是否等于“完成”,应写为A1=”完成”,若遗漏引号,公式通常会报错。其三,过度嵌套导致公式可读性急剧下降。当条件数量超过四五个时,应考虑是否可以通过辅助列分步计算,或者使用其他如“布尔乘法”等技巧来简化公式。其四,忽略其“短路求值”特性可能带来的副作用。例如,当某个条件包含除零错误等运算时,若其前面的条件已为假,则错误不会触发;但若调整了条件顺序,则可能引发公式错误,这一点在调试复杂公式时需要留意。 五、 进阶思路与性能优化探讨 对于追求效率与优雅的资深用户,可以探索更多可能性。一种思路是利用逻辑值的数学特性,将多个“与”条件相乘。因为“真”可视为1,“假”可视为0,所以多个条件相乘的结果为1时,等价于所有条件为真。这种写法在数组公式中有时更为简洁。另一种思路是结合最新的函数环境,如利用“筛选”函数配合乘法运算,直接从一个数据区域中提取出满足多重条件的记录,这比传统数组公式更加直观和高效。在处理超大型数据集时,还应注意公式的易读性,适当地将复杂的多重判断拆解到多个单元格中分步计算,虽然可能略微增加表格的宽度或长度,但能极大地方便后期的检查、维护和修改,从长远看是更优的选择。 综上所述,掌握“与”逻辑函数的精髓,远不止于记住其语法。它要求使用者具备清晰的逻辑思维,能够将现实业务中的复杂规则准确地翻译为公式语言,并通过巧妙的组合与嵌套,让电子表格真正成为自动化、智能化的数据分析助手。从简单的真假判断到驱动复杂的业务规则,它的身影无处不在,是每一位数据工作者工具箱中不可或缺的利器。
202人看过